The size of Port Macquarie is approximately 54.2 square kilometres. It has 61 parks covering nearly 17.2% of total area. The population of Port Macquarie in 2011 was 41,491 people. By 2016 the population was 44,857 showing a population growth of 8.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Port Macquarie is 60-69 years. Households in Port Macquarie are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Port Macquarie work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 64.9% of the homes in Port Macquarie were owner-occupied compared with 64% in 2016.
Port Macquarie has 28,742 properties.
